设计构造哈希表的完整算法-求出平均查找长度(共6页).doc

上传人:晟*** 文档编号:10368293 上传时间:2022-01-12 格式:DOC 页数:6 大小:85KB
下载 相关 举报
设计构造哈希表的完整算法-求出平均查找长度(共6页).doc_第1页
第1页 / 共6页
设计构造哈希表的完整算法-求出平均查找长度(共6页).doc_第2页
第2页 / 共6页
设计构造哈希表的完整算法-求出平均查找长度(共6页).doc_第3页
第3页 / 共6页
设计构造哈希表的完整算法-求出平均查找长度(共6页).doc_第4页
第4页 / 共6页
设计构造哈希表的完整算法-求出平均查找长度(共6页).doc_第5页
第5页 / 共6页
点击查看更多>>
资源描述

精选优质文档-倾情为你奉上程序设计与算法分析实验报告一 设计的目的与内容1.设计目的通过本实验需要掌握构造哈希函数表,需要完成设计构造哈希表的 完整算法,并求出平均查找长度。2 实验内容使用哈希函数:H(K)=3*K MOD 11 并采用开放地址法解决冲突,试在0到10的散列地址空间对关键字序列( 22, 41, 53, 46, 30,13, 01,67)构造哈希函数表,并设计构造哈希表的完整算法,并求出平均查找长度。二 算法的基本思想1. 数据结构的设计哈希函数 H ( key ) =3* key mod 11,哈希表的地址空间为 0 10,对关键字序列( 22, 41, 53, 46, 30,13, 01,67)按线性探测再散列和二次探测再散列的方法分别构造哈希表。 ( 1 )线性探测再散列: 3*22 11 = 0; 3*41 11=2 ; 3*53 11 = 5 ;3* 46%11=6;3*30%11=2发生冲突,下一个存储地址( 2 1 ) 11 3 ;3*13%11=6发生冲突,下一个存

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 实用文档资料库 > 公文范文

Copyright © 2018-2021 Wenke99.com All rights reserved

工信部备案号浙ICP备20026746号-2  

公安局备案号:浙公网安备33038302330469号

本站为C2C交文档易平台,即用户上传的文档直接卖给下载用户,本站只是网络服务中间平台,所有原创文档下载所得归上传人所有,若您发现上传作品侵犯了您的权利,请立刻联系网站客服并提供证据,平台将在3个工作日内予以改正。